How do I access this service?

Referral

All our services require a referral. See below:

Residential services - This service is funded by the Ministry of Health, and people need to be accessed by the local Needs Assessment and Service Coordination service, called Disability Support Link (DSL).  DSL do a needs assessment to decide how much support a person needs, and can then refer them to us. 

Living my Life - To access Living My Life, a person needs to be referred to us by ACC. 

Transition from school - The Ministry of Social Development fund Transition for young people who are ORS funded, between 16-21 years old and in their final year of school.

Supported Independent Living (SIL) - This is Ministry of Health funded, and people get referred to SIL by Disability Support Link. 

Very High Needs Day Programme - This is funded by the Ministry of Social Development, and usually a person is either referred by their transition coordinator, or by family.
